POSITION SUMMARY:

The installer works with Project Manager to install fabricated stone pieces in homes according to Company policy and standards of quality.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

1. Installs and finishes materials on the job site, including cutting materials and finishing seams.
2. Works assigned installs efficiently and effectively and keeps the Outside Operations Manager informed of activities in the installation team.
3. Keep trucks and jobsites clean and free of debris, and to sufficiently protect to avoid damage to customer’s property.

WORK ENVIRONMENT:

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those the incumbent

enc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be

made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

This position will be working primarily indoors in a construction environment, but also requires the employee to be in the outdoors on a regular basis, including varying weather conditions and temperatures. The normal auto and air travel hazards will apply. Travel will be in all types of weather including heavy rain and below freezing temperatures with snow conditions. The noise level in the work environment is usually high due to the proximity of saws, grinders, etc., but can be lower in the other areas of the building. There will be exposure to different types of adhesives, including but not limited to epoxy, silicone, and thin-set mortar. Exposure to injury due to operation of heavy manufacturing equipment and moving large pieces of stone and tile. Exposure to dust particles, fumes, and other manufacturing hazards.
